Methodology: How We Ranked the Best Solar Companies in Mosinee

EcoWatch's solar experts analyzed each solar company in Mosinee based on criteria such as its reputation in the industry, customer reviews, services, warranty coverage and financing. Using this solar methodology, we used the data we collected to rate and rank each company and narrow down our picks for the best solar companies in Mosinee


Below are some the criteria we examined specifically for Wisconsin solar companies

  • Brand reputation and certifications (20%): We take each company's Better Business Bureau (BBB) score into consideration, as well as how long the installer has been in business (at least 5 years is required, 10 preferred) and what type of solar certifications it holds.
  • Customer reviews (20%): Trust is a top priority at EcoWatch, so we take customer experience under close consideration. We scour different review sites and customer testimonials when ranking our top solar companies, checking sites such as Trustpilot and Google Reviews. We also consider any potential complaints or lawsuits filed against these companies and award or remove points accordingly.
  • Warranty (20%): A company earns a perfect score in this category if it offers 25-year warranties that cover performance, product and workmanship. The industry standard that we measure companies against is 25-year product and performance warranties, along with a 10-year workmanship warranty. We also look closely into the track record of the post-installation support each company provides in terms of honoring its contracts
  • Solar services (10%): All of the companies we review install solar panels, but we award companies higher points if they offer additional services for customers, like battery installation, energy-efficiency audits, and EV chargers.
  • Pricing and financing (10%): It's hard to get exact quotes for solar projects, but we use marketplace research to determine how each company prices its equipment and installation services. Additionally, companies that offer more help for panel financing — like in-house loans, leases, or PPAs — score higher than those that don't.
  • Availability (10%): The bigger the service area, the higher the company will score.
  • Transparency and accessibility (5%): Solar installers that offer free consultations and easy contact methods score higher in this category.
  • Environmental, social and corporate governance factors (5%): A company earns a perfect score in this category if it offers public data disclosure, addresses end-of-life (EOL) products or processes, and demonstrates a commitment to uplifting the communities that it serves.

The Cost and Benefits of Solar in Mosinee

When picking a solar company, most homeowners or business owners wonder about the costs above all.The cost of solar and the savings it generates vary depending on some important factors such as:

  • How much energy your home consumes: Households that need plenty of energy each month may need more solar panels and, consequently, more upfront cost, but will also save more on their energy bills over time.
  • Choice of solar panels: The kind of solar panels you choose will affect your total cost. High-efficiency monocrystalline panels will cost more upfront but can also save you more money over the lifetime of your system. If you don’t need to maximize efficiency, you can opt for a higher number of more affordable panels.
  • Incentives: Along with the federal Solar Investment Tax Credit (ITC), which lets you receive a tax credit curretnly worth 0 of your overall installation cost, your state or local government may offer additional tax exemptions, credits or rebates that will help you save even more. Aside from incentives, you can save an average of $21,000 over 20 years with your system, too.
  • How much sunlight your roof gets: If your roof doesn’t get a lot of direct sunlight, your solar panel system won’t be able to produce as much energy, which will give you lower savings on electric bills than someone with a roof that gets lots of sunlight.

What is the negative environmental impact of making solar panels?

Solar panels can be harmful for the environment when manufacturers use toxic chemicals when they’re made. Chemicals can make solar panels difficult to recycle safely once they’ve reached the end of their lifespan. Making solar panels needs a lot of energy as well. The energy payback period is about 1 to 4 years.

How long does it take for solar to pay for itself?

Solar panels generally pay for themselves in about 12.3 years, but your solar payback period will vary depending on your utility costs. The more your typical energy bill, the faster your solar panel system will recoup your installation costs.

What are the different kinds of solar panels?

The different types of solar panels are monocrystalline, polycrystalline and thin-film. Monocrystalline panels are more efficient but also more expensive. Polycrystalline panels are less expensive but also less efficient than monocrystalline. Thin-film solar panels are flexible, so they can be used where the other kinds can’t, like on curved surfaces or cars, but they are also less efficient. The best one for you depends on your budget, roof layout and how much efficiency you're looking for.
